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Glen St. Mary, FL

The cost of Under Sink Water Extraction in Glen St. Mary,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ate to help you understand the costs involved. Free Estimates Transparent Pricing and Expert Technicians that’s what you can expect from our team.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of drying process.
Repair and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, type of repairs needed, and materials used.
Free Estimate and Inspection $0 – $100 Distance from our location, time of day, and complexity of inspection.

The prices listed above are estimates and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ation.
